The Global Certificate in Art History & Environmental Studies is a unique course that combines the study of art history with environmental awareness. This interdisciplinary approach is increasingly important in today's world, where the impact of climate change and the need for sustainable practices are becoming more prominent.

This course is designed to equip learners with essential skills for career advancement in fields such as museum studies, art conservation, environmental policy, and sustainable design. By examining the relationship between art and the environment, learners will gain a deeper understanding of the cultural and historical significance of art, as well as the ethical considerations of preserving it in a changing world. With a focus on practical skills and real-world applications, this course is in high demand in industries that value interdisciplinary thinking and a sustainable approach to cultural preservation. By completing this course, learners will not only be prepared for careers in these fields, but they will also be contributing to a more sustainable and equitable future for all.

Course Details


• Art History Overview
• Environmental Studies Fundamentals
• Art & Environment: Intersections
• Environmental Art: History & Movements
• Artistic Representations of Nature & Climate Change
• Sustainable Art Practices
• Environmental Impact of Art
• Art, Activism & Environmental Advocacy
• Global Case Studies in Environmental Art
• Green Cultural Policy & Arts Funding
